AEAE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2022 in Review

70 of the 6,221 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in AltEnergy Acquisition Corp (AEAE) for Q4 2022, worth a combined $205M — up 2.9% from $199M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 13 funds opened new AEAE positions and 8 closed out — a net gain of 5 holders — while 8 added to existing stakes and 8 trimmed.

The largest buyer was HSBC Holdings, opening a new position worth an estimated $5.31M. The largest seller was Verition Fund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$5.29M sold.
